zi6 ngo5自我

Jyutpingzi6 ngo5
Yalejih ngóh
形容詞Common

Definition

Oneself, self-, or self-centered.

  1. oneself; self-
  2. self-centered; egoistic
colloquialpeopledescriptions

How it's used

Describes someone who is overly focused on their own perspective or desires, often carrying a negative connotation of being selfish or stubborn. When used as a noun prefix like in 自我介紹, it functions neutrally, but when used as an adjective to describe a person, it implies a lack of consideration for others.

Examples

He is very self-centered and never cares about how others feel.
Don't be so self-centered at work, you need to learn how to cooperate with others.

Common phrases

Common mistake

Learners often confuse this with 自私, which specifically means selfish. While 自私 focuses on keeping benefits for oneself, 自我 focuses on prioritizing one's own viewpoint or ego above all else.
